git命令行推送远端仓库

worktile 其他 65

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    将本地仓库推送到远程仓库,使用git命令行可以按照以下步骤进行操作:

    1. 确定本地仓库与远程仓库的连接:首先需要在本地仓库中进行设置,将本地仓库与远程仓库进行连接。可以使用以下命令添加远程仓库的URL:

    “`
    git remote add origin <远程仓库URL>
    “`

    该命令将远程仓库的URL添加到本地仓库,并将其命名为”origin”。可以使用其他名称,但通常情况下使用”origin”。

    2. 将本地更改提交到本地仓库:在推送之前,确保已将本地更改提交到本地仓库。可以使用以下命令将更改提交为一个新的提交:

    “`
    git commit -m “提交信息”
    “`

    在双引号中填写提交信息,描述本次提交的内容。

    3. 推送本地仓库到远程仓库:当提交完成后,可以使用以下命令将本地仓库推送到远程仓库:

    “`
    git push origin <分支名>
    “`

    在尖括号中填写需要推送的分支名。常用的分支名包括”master”和”main”。

    4. 输入远程仓库的用户名和密码(可选):如果远程仓库需要身份验证,会要求输入远程仓库的用户名和密码。

    5. 等待推送完成:推送完成后,命令行会显示推送的进度和状态。当显示成功时,即可确认推送已完成。

    需要注意的是,如果本地仓库和远程仓库存在冲突(即两者的提交历史不一致),推送可能会失败。在这种情况下,需要先将远程仓库的更新拉取到本地仓库,解决冲突后再进行推送。可以使用以下命令拉取远程仓库的更新:

    “`
    git pull origin <分支名>
    “`

    然后根据提示解决冲突,并重新进行提交和推送。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Git是一个分布式版本控制系统,它提供了许多命令行工具来管理和操作代码仓库。推送(Push)是一个常用的操作,它将本地代码的改动推送到远程仓库中。下面是使用Git命令行推送远程仓库的几个步骤:

    1. 确认远程仓库
    在推送代码之前,你需要先确认本地仓库已经与远程仓库建立了连接。可以通过以下命令查看当前的远程仓库信息:
    “`
    git remote -v
    “`
    如果没有任何输出,说明还没有远程仓库。你需要先添加一个远程仓库,使用命令:
    “`
    git remote add origin <远程仓库的URL>
    “`
    其中,`origin`是远程仓库的别名,你可以自定义。`<远程仓库的URL>`是远程仓库的地址。

    2. 添加和提交改动
    在推送之前,你需要将本地的改动先添加和提交到本地仓库。使用以下命令添加所有改动:
    “`
    git add .
    “`
    如果你只想添加特定的文件,可以将`.`替换为文件名。然后,使用以下命令提交改动并添加提交信息:
    “`
    git commit -m “提交信息”
    “`

    3. 推送到远程仓库
    当本地代码改动已经提交后,你可以使用以下命令将改动推送到远程仓库:
    “`
    git push origin <分支名>
    “`
    其中,`<分支名>`是你要推送的本地分支名称,比如`master`或者`develop`。这条命令会将本地分支的改动推送到远程仓库的对应分支。

    4. 处理推送冲突
    如果其他人在你之前推送了改动到远程仓库并且与你的改动发生了冲突,推送操作会失败。此时,你需要先解决冲突,然后再次尝试推送。可以使用以下命令查看冲突的文件:
    “`
    git status
    “`
    然后手动编辑冲突文件,解决冲突后重新提交和推送。

    5. 其他推送选项
    除了普通的推送操作,还有一些其他的推送选项可以用于特殊情况。例如,如果你想将本地分支推送到一个不同的远程分支,可以使用以下命令:
    “`
    git push origin <本地分支>:<远程分支>
    “`
    其中,`<本地分支>`是你要推送的本地分支名称,`<远程分支>`是你要推送到的远程分支名称。

    总结:
    推送(Push)是Git中将本地代码改动推送到远程仓库的操作。为了推送代码需要先确认远程仓库的连接,在本地添加和提交改动后,使用`git push`命令即可将改动推送到远程仓库。如果有冲突产生,需要解决冲突后再次尝试推送。此外,还可以使用其他推送选项来满足特殊需求。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在使用Git进行版本控制时,推送(Push)操作是将本地代码的修改提交到远程仓库的一种方式。通过推送操作,可以将本地代码共享给团队的其他成员或者备份到远程仓库。下面是git命令行推送远程仓库的操作流程:

    1. 确定远程仓库地址:在推送之前,首先需要确定远程仓库的地址。一般来说,远程仓库的地址是一个URL,可以以HTTPS或SSH的方式访问。可以使用以下命令查看当前远程仓库设置:
    “`
    $ git remote -v
    “`
    如果没有设置远程仓库,可以使用以下命令添加一个远程仓库:
    “`
    $ git remote add
    “`
    其中,``是远程仓库的名称,可以自定义;``是远程仓库的URL。

    2. 推送到远程仓库:在本地代码修改完成之后,可以使用以下命令进行推送操作:
    “`
    $ git push
    “`
    其中,``是远程仓库的名称;``是要推送到远程仓库的分支名称。一般来说,`origin`是默认的远程仓库名称,`master`是默认的主分支名称。

    3. 凭据验证:当首次推送到远程仓库或者在推送过程中需要进行凭据验证时,可以根据配置进行身份验证。根据使用的协议不同,可以使用不同的凭据验证方式。对于HTTPS协议,可以使用用户名和密码验证,也可以使用Git凭据管理器进行身份验证。对于SSH协议,需要进行SSH密钥的配置。

    4. 强制推送:如果需要覆盖远程仓库的代码,可以使用强制推送(Force Push)操作。一般来说,强制推送不是推荐使用的方式,因为可能会导致远程仓库的代码丢失或冲突。可以使用以下命令进行强制推送:
    “`
    $ git push -f
    “`
    其中,`-f`参数表示强制推送。

    5. 推送标签:除了推送分支,还可以推送标签(Tags)。标签是用于标记具有重要里程碑的提交,比如版本发布等。可以使用以下命令进行标签推送:
    “`
    $ git push
    “`
    其中,`
    `是要推送的标签名称。

    总结:通过以上步骤,可以使用git命令行推送本地代码到远程仓库。推送操作是团队合作和备份代码的重要环节,需要正确配置远程仓库和凭据验证,并根据需要选择是否使用强制推送。同时,还可以推送标签来标记重要的里程碑。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部